    My new baby is coming along quickly

    I've had Scout for just over two weeks. I haven't officially adopted her because we are still in the trial period but things are going great. She's been out in the house with Ripley and Jazz for a week now and they are all getting along great. The first few days she would hiss and growl, especially at Jazz but now they are playing and hanging out together. I haven't seen them grooming each other or sleeping together but I feel that is soon to come. I think Scout also respects that Ripley is older and doesn't want to play or be bothered so there have been no issues with them either.

    My only concern is our litter box set up. We keep the boxes in a room in the garage that the cats access through a pet door in the laundry room. Ripley and Jazz have always used that with no problems but Scout has to be encouraged through to the room. She will use the boxes and then comes back in with no problem but it is like she forgets where she needs to go to get out. As far as I can tell she has had no accidents but I usually watch her and show her where to go several times a day. My husband will not let me officially adopt her until we see her going on her own for a few days. I really don't think it will be a problem.

    I'm just so pleased with how well they are all adusting. It certainly wasn't like that when I brought Jazz in to meet Ripley last year.

    Cats are pretty smart creatures. Sounds like Scout has you trained to hold the door open for her.

    Try not doing this for a day and just keeping an eye on her to see if she can get through the flap on her own.
